Foreign object found in food, workers revolt: We will win by resisting
Workers at the Fikirtepe urban transformation construction site in Istanbul staged a protest with chants of 'management resign' after foreign objects were found in the food provided to them.
Workers at the Torkam construction site in Istanbul's Fikirtepe district revolted after a 'foreign object' was found in the food provided to them. The workers gathered in front of the construction site and staged a protest with chants of "We will win by resisting" and "Management resign."
Meanwhile, the workers protested their employers by overturning tables and chairs in the cafeteria.

In a statement made on the social media account of the Construction and Building Workers Union, the following expressions were included:
"A protest was carried out with chants of 'management resign' due to foreign objects found in the food provided to our fellow workers at the Istanbul Fikirtepe urban transformation construction site.
We do not accept nutritional conditions that are contrary to human dignity.
Kuzu Grup, which tries to condemn construction workers to conditions of slavery, must immediately provide nutritional conditions worthy of human dignity.
Our union management and our fellow workers who are members of our union at the construction site will follow up on the matter."
